If I use a cable modem or DSL, how do I keep my computer secure?
Regardless of your operating system, you need to be vigilant about the possible security risks involved with connecting to the Internet via cable modem or DSL, as your computer may be connected to the Internet for long periods of time with a static IP address.
For all systems, follow the instructions in Best practices for computer security.
